Really sorry to hear about your OML.

I think you must first find out from the CAA whether you would be able to hold a Single Pilot Multi-Engine IR with that limitation. If not, then only an MPL is possible for you commercially; tagged onto an airline scheme.

Of course as you say, you can keep enjoying yourself with your current PPL even though you are restricted for Class1.

And btw, you can paradrop/ tow gliders with a PPL.
